Bills make GQ's list of 'worst sports franchises of all time'

The Buffalo Bills are being heralded as one of the 20 worst sports franchises of all-time by GQ Magazine.

"Their most famous player was O. J. Simpson, and their greatest feat was losing a record four straight Super Bowls," the article reads. "And that was two decades ago. Things have gotten so bad for the Bills that they now play one home game a year in ...Toronto."

GQ ranks the Bills No. 17 on its list but Buffalo isn't the only NFL team mentioned. The Detroit Lions (No. 2), New York Jets (No. 6) and Arizona Cardinals (No. 19) also made the cut.

The Bills have not made the playoffs in 13 consecutive seasons.
